An additional choice is to do away with the mid-day hours totally and fire pictures during what's referred to as the gold hour. This typically starts concerning an hour prior to sundown (or from sunup to an hour after) but can vary relying on your precise area. Throughout this short window of time, the sunlight is short on the perspective and it bathes your scene in an abundant, cozy light that is impressive for portraits.
Whatever looks so abundant and beautiful during this time around, but it passes rapidly so ensure to use your time intelligently and work effectively to get the shots you desire. Grand Teton National Park is attractive year-round, however each season provides a special vibe for your Grand Teton family photos: Lavish plant, wildflowers, and cozy weather make this a preferred time for photoshoots. The entire park is open and all picture spots come (Family Photography Session Mira Loma). Great deals of range in places. Golden loss shades around the Snake River and Lakes, and crisp air create a magical, comfy environment.
Snow-covered landscapes and fewer groups supply a calm, wintertime heaven background. Limited spots because of much of the park closing for winter. Melting snow and starting of environment-friendly shades. Still can be chilly. Pro Pointer: Schedule your session early, especially for summer season and autumn, as these are the most popular times for digital photography in the park.

Believe denim coats, cardigans, or comfortable scarves. You might need to stroll to your photoshoot place, so opt for comfortable shoes. You remain in a National forest and in the middle of wildlife. Heels don't constantly lead themselves well for going down dirt paths, getting involved in the greenery of the landscape, and moving conveniently among rocks.
Grand Teton National forest has certain guidelines for digital photography: A permit is required for industrial digital photography, however a lot of household sessions fall under personal use and do not need one. Remain on marked trails and regard the native environment. Prevent troubling wild animals and follow Leave No Trace concepts.
